Get started8 Wayland Way is a two-bedroom semi-detached house in Banham, Norwich, Norwich (NR16 2EB). It has a recorded floor area of 65 m² (around 700 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1983-1990 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(August 2023) shows a D (score 65),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since May 2013. Between certificates, lighting went from Poor to Very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 82), a 2-band jump. Main heating runs on oil. Other recorded features include a conservatory. The home occupies a cul-de-sac position.
Sale prices here have outpaced Norwich HPI: 6.2%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£202,000 sits 61.6% above the 2013 sale of £125,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£179/sq ft) was about 130.5% above the typical sold price in the postcode. It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 71% of similar EPCs). Last sold in August 2013, so it's been off the market for around 13 years.
